- Pop-up wild campsite in a secluded valley at Coedpoeth, North Wales
- Pontcysyllte Aqueduct and Park in the Past both 15 minutes’ drive
- Car-free site with hike-in access; archery and bushcraft available

Primitive grass tent campsite (family)
Liked The location was great. Once down in the valley we felt miles from anywhere, even though Coedpoeth was just a few minutes walk away. Nick the owner was really accommodating, popped down to greet us and say hi. I went for the night with my 12 year old son, who's been desperate to wild camp for ages and this was a great introduction. We were there with one other camper who was in a different part of the valley but wouldn't have known they were there due to the layout offering really secluded private pitches. We set up camp, chilled for a bit, lit the fire and made bacon cheeseburgers...perfect
Disliked Toilet is a little bit of a challenge to get to, especially in the dark
